stats: incorrect clock square algorithm

Since the original IBM code import, OpenAFS has an algorithm for
squaring clock values, implemented identically in three different
places.  This algorithm does not account correctly for microsecs
overflow into seconds, resulting in incorrect "sum-of-squares" values
for queue and execution time in several OpenAFS performance utilities.

Specifically, this code:

        t1.tv_usec += (2 * t2.tv_sec * t2.tv_usec) % 1000000                   \
                      + (t2.tv_usec / 1000)*(t2.tv_usec / 1000)                \
                      + 2 * (t2.tv_usec / 1000) * (t2.tv_usec % 1000) / 1000   \
                      + (((t2.tv_usec % 1000) > 707) ? 1 : 0);                 \

Can allow for the tv_usec field to be increased by a theoretical max
of around:

        t1.tv_usec += 999998                                                   \
                      + 999*999                                                \
                      + 2 * 999 * 999 / 1000                                   \
                      + 1;                                                     \

Or:

        t1.tv_usec += 1999996;                                                 \

If t1.tv_usec is already 999999, after this calculation its value
could be as high as 2999995. So just checking once if t1.tv_usec is
over 1000000 is not sufficient, since the resulting value (1999995) is
still over 1000000.

Correct all implementations by repeatedly checking if tv_usec is over
1000000 after the above calculation:

macro                   affected utility
=====================   ============================
afs_stats_SquareAddTo   xstat_cm_test
fs_stats_SquareAddTo    xstat_fs_test
clock_AddSq             rxstat_get_process and _peer
